More About LONI
LONI focuses on software that deploys autonomous agents to automate digital workflows across enterprise environments. Its platform is aimed at organizations that want to encode repeatable processes into AI-driven agents that can operate with minimal human intervention while still fitting within existing systems and controls. The company presents its offering as a way to handle structured, procedural work, especially in knowledge-heavy and operations-heavy domains, by turning written procedures or task descriptions into executable workflows.
The core concept behind LONI’s offering is orchestration of multiple agents that can collaborate on a workflow, pass context between steps, and interact with external applications and data sources. In an enterprise setting, this typically means connecting to APIs, internal tools, Software-as-a-Service (SaaS) applications, or data platforms, so that agents can read information, apply logic, and take follow-up actions such as updating records or generating reports. The platform emphasizes configuration of workflows through task definitions and rules rather than traditional hard-coded logic, which aligns with usage by operations, product, or business teams in addition to engineering stakeholders.
From a technology perspective, LONI relies on large language models and related AI techniques to interpret instructions, maintain context across steps, and make decisions within bounded workflows. The platform is structured so that enterprises can define guardrails, specify roles for each agent, and determine which systems each agent can access. This approach is consistent with broader enterprise AI orchestration tools, where governance, security, and observability over automated actions are central technical requirements. LONI’s offering sits in the AI workflow orchestration and automation category, alongside tools that manage prompts, tools, and multi-step flows across heterogeneous back-end services.
For enterprise architects and CTOs evaluating AI deployments, LONI’s agents can be positioned as an abstraction layer between large language models and business applications. Instead of exposing raw model calls to end users, organizations can build agent-based workflows that embed procedures and compliance requirements into the automation layer. This can be relevant in domains such as customer operations, internal support, and back-office processes where tasks follow repeatable patterns but still require language understanding and context handling.
